Often feel sad and helpless
One of my friend often feel sad and helpless. He is scared of loosing job for no reason, loosing everything for no reason. He is already taking one medicine pregablin and nortiphylin tablet. Sometimes he get chills while thinking is what he informed me. He eats alot when he is thinking. Not sure if this is normal or anything to be worried about. He is always sad most of the times.

It seems to be stress disorder leading to mild depression. It needs to be treated asap otherwise it may get complicated. It can be well treated with counseling sessions and medication if required.

Hello Seems like he may be suffering from anxiety disorder. Psychotherapy treatment will help to improve his mental health. He needs to speak about that what kind of anxiety thoughts disturbing him regularly, how it is affecting his daily activities and of course he needs to do some Relaxation techniques as well. So pls let him consult with a Psychologist for further assessment. Don't worry. Give some support to him.
